Our architect has finally placed the deed for the hall in my hands. Being of naturally nervous disposition I was wondering when exactly in the placing process it brings up the issue of city cap.


Just before the reset today, I had a quick test run, and the box telling you that the building will be undeedable when placed came up. If that means we're not at the cap I shall be most pleased.


Mainly I just want to make sure that it doesn't let you place, THEN bring up the cap issue. That'd be an insane way to do it, but like I said, naturally nervous disposition.

1) It tells you the building is not re-deedable


2) It asks you for a city name


3) After you click 'OK' on #2, it then checks the cap, if the cap has been hit, you get a system message telling you that your planet has hit the cap. If your planet has not hit the cap, well, I assume it goes to the structure placement window, but I havent made it that far yet.


All the 'Not-Redeedable' message means is that unlike houses, once you do place, you cannot re-deed it. It can only be destored by click ing 'Destroy Structure' or by not paying maint or by not meeting minimum city population reqs.

If the map doesn't come up to place it like a house or any other structure, then you're at thecap.


I had the map come up, I found green, then tried to place it........but was unable from the cap hit. I missed it by seconds.


After that, the map never came up again, and I get the "planet has reached cap" message. Your deed is safe until the City is placed. If you place it, its not wasted, you're good to go.
